The Role of Internal Audits in Modern Business Governance
An internal audit is a systematic, independent, and objective evaluation of an organization's operations, risk management, control, and governance processes. Its primary purpose is to add value and improve an organization's operations by bringing a disciplined approach to evaluate and enhance the effectiveness of these functions. For UAE-based companies, this is particularly critical. The nation's regulatory environment, influenced by both local laws and international standards (such as ADGM and DIFC regulations), requires meticulous compliance. Internal audits help businesses navigate these requirements, identifying gaps before they escalate into costly regulatory penalties or reputational damage.

Key Benefits of Implementing Smart Internal Audits
Enhanced Risk Management: Smart internal audits move beyond traditional financial checks. They employ data analytics and technology to proactively identify emerging risks, from cybersecurity threats in an increasingly digital economy to supply chain vulnerabilities. This allows management to mitigate potential issues before they impact the bottom line.
Regulatory Compliance Assurance: With authorities like the Securities and Commodities Authority (SCA) and the Central Bank of the UAE continuously updating frameworks, maintaining compliance is a moving target. Internal audits provide an ongoing assurance mechanism, ensuring that business practices align with the latest legal and regulatory mandates, thereby avoiding hefty fines and legal entanglements.
Operational Efficiency and Cost Savings: By scrutinizing internal processes, audits often uncover inefficiencies, redundancies, and waste. Streamlining these processes not only strengthens controls but also leads to significant cost savings and improved resource allocation, directly boosting profitability.
Informed Strategic Decision-Making: The insights generated from audit findings provide the C-suite and board of directors with factual, data-driven intelligence. This empowers leadership to make strategic decisions with a comprehensive understanding of the organization's risk profile and operational health.
Strengthened Investor and Stakeholder Confidence: Demonstrating a commitment to transparency and good governance through regular internal audits enhances your company's reputation. This builds trust with investors, partners, and customers, which is invaluable for long-term growth and capital attraction.
Integrating Technology: The Future of Auditing in the UAE
The future of internal auditing is inextricably linked to technology. The UAE's national agenda emphatically supports digital innovation, and audit functions are evolving to keep pace. Predictive analytics, Artificial Intelligence (AI), and robotic process automation (RPA) are transforming audit from a historical review to a forward-looking, predictive function. AI algorithms can analyze 100% of transaction data instead of a small sample, identifying anomalous patterns indicative of fraud or error.
